I graphed these vertices myself in the attached photo, and it turned out to be a rectangle; With the thought that you perhaps made a typo and meant rectangle instead of polygon I continued on and found the perimeter of the rectangle.
The formula for finding the perimeter of a rectangle is P = 2(l+w).
I counted the units of the long side (K & J) to get the length, which is 7.
Next, I counted the units between J & H to find the width which is 4. Now we're ready to use the formula.
First I will add the length plus the width, 7 + 4 = 11.
Then I will multiply 2 x 11 to get a product of 22.
P = 22. :D

Let the number be x.
8 - x = x -34
2x = 8 + 34
2x = 42
x = 21
Answer: The number is 21.
